diff --git a/ui/v2.5/src/components/Performers/PerformerDetails/PerformerDetailsPanel.tsx b/ui/v2.5/src/components/Performers/PerformerDetails/PerformerDetailsPanel.tsx index 900015bc3..c4a85d440 100644 --- a/ui/v2.5/src/components/Performers/PerformerDetails/PerformerDetailsPanel.tsx +++ b/ui/v2.5/src/components/Performers/PerformerDetails/PerformerDetailsPanel.tsx @@ -239,8 +239,8 @@ export const PerformerDetailsPanel: React.FC = ({ }); useEffect(() => { - updatePerformerEditState(performer); - }, [performer]); + if (!isNew) updatePerformerEditState(performer); + }, [isNew, performer]); useEffect(() => { if (onImageChange) { @@ -562,7 +562,7 @@ export const PerformerDetailsPanel: React.FC = ({ /> {isEditing ? (